About Department for Education
The Department for Education is a ministerial department of the UK government. The department is responsible for children's services and education policy across England, covering early years, schools, higher education, further education, apprenticeships, and skills.
Supported by 14 agencies and public bodies, the department develops legislative frameworks, sets educational standards, and manages initiatives such as school food standards, educational technology integration, and performance measures for schools and colleges.
